Beef Showmanship Parts of a Steer Wholesale Cuts of a Market Steer Common Cattle Breeds Angus (English) Maine Anjou Charolaise Short Horn Hereford (English) Simmental Showmanship Terms/Questions Bull: an intact adult male Steer: a male castrated prior to development of secondary sexual characteristics Stag: a male castrated after development of secondary sexual characteristics Cow: a female that has given birth Heifer: a young female that has not yet given birth Calf: a young bovine animal Polled: a beef animal that naturally lacks horns 1. What is the feed conversion ratio for cattle? a. 7 lbs. feed/1 lb. gain 2. About what % of water will a calf drink of its body weight in cold weather? a. 8% …and in hot weather? a. 19% 2. What is the average daily weight gain of a market steer? a. 2.0 – 4 lbs./day 3. What is the approximate percent crude protein that growing cattle should be fed? a. 12 – 16% 4. What is the most common concentrate in beef rations? a. Corn 5. What are three examples of feed ingredients used as a protein source in a ration? a. Cottonseed meal, soybean meal, distillers grain brewers grain, corn gluten meal 6. Name two forage products used in a beef cattle ration: a. Alfalfa, hay, ground alfalfa, leaf meal, ground grass 7. What is the normal temperature of a cow? a. 101.0°F 8. The gestation period for a cow is…? a. 285 days (9 months, 7 days) 9. How many stomachs does a steer have? Name them. a. 4: Rumen, Omasum, Abomasum, and Reticulum 10. -

Animal Behaviour, Animal Welfare and the Scientific Study of Affect David Fraser University of British Columbia KEYWORDS animal behaviour, animal welfare, affect, emotion, qualitative research ABSTRACT Many questions about animal welfare involve the affective states of animals (pain, fear, distress) and people look to science to clarify these issues as a basis for practices, policies and standards. However, the science of the mid twentieth century tended to be silent on matters of animal affect for both philosophical and methodological reasons. Philosophically, under the influence of Positivism many scientists considered that the affective states of animals fall outside the scope of science. Certain methodological features of the research also favoured explanations that did not involve affect. The features included the tendency to rely on abstract, quantitative measures rather than description, to use controlled experiments more than naturalistic observation, and to focus on measures of central tendency (means, medians) rather than individual differences. -

SUNSTEIN** I INTRODUCTION Many consumers would be willing to pay something to reduce the suffering of animals used as food. Unfortunately, they do not and cannot, because existing markets do not disclose the relevant treatment of animals, even though that treatment would trouble many consumers. Steps should be taken to promote disclosure so as to fortify market processes and to promote democratic discussion of the treatment of animals. In the context of animal welfare, a serious problem is that people’s practices ensure outcomes that defy their existing moral commitments. A disclosure regime could improve animal welfare without making it necessary to resolve the most deeply contested questions in this domain. II OF THEORIES AND PRACTICES To all appearances, disputes over animal rights produce an extraordinary amount of polarization and acrimony. Some people believe that those who defend animal rights are zealots, showing an inexplicable willingness to sacrifice important human interests for the sake of rats, pigs, and salmon. Judge Richard Posner, for example, refers to “the siren song of animal rights,”1 while Richard Epstein complains that recognition of an “animal right to bodily integrity . Factors Affecting the Palatability of Lamb Meat Susan K. Duckett University of Georgia Introduction In the last 43 years, per capita consumption of lamb in the United States has declined to a level of 0.81 lb per person annually on a boneless, retail weight basis (CattleFax, 2003; Figure 1). In contrast, per capita consumption of total meat products has increased 28% to about 194 lb per person annually in this same time period (Figure 2). In 2003, per capita consumption of beef, pork, poultry and fish products was estimated at 62, 48, 68,and 15 lb (boneless, retail weight basis), respectively. These consumption patterns indicate that Americans continue to consume greater amounts of meat in their diet; however, lamb consumption continues to decline. In a survey conducted of 600 households (Ward et al., 1995; Tulsa, OK), consumers were asked to rank seven meats including beef, chicken, fish, lamb, pork, turkey, and veal on taste, cholesterol content, nutritional content, economic value, fat, convenience, and overall preference (scale: 1st would be most desirable and 7th would be least desirable for these traits). Consumers identified taste as one of the most important factors when purchasing meat and ranked lamb last (lowest preference) among the seven meats for taste and overall preference (Table 1). Consumers ranked lamb 5th for cholesterol level, 6th for nutritional content, and 5th for fat level. Lamb is higher in polyunsaturated fatty acids and conjugated linoleic acid (anticarcinogen), and lower in total fat content than grain-fed beef (Figure 3); however, most consumers appear unaware of potential nutritional benefits from including lamb in the diet. -

This article is an open access publication Abstract The possibility of ‘‘clean milk’’—dairy produced without the need for cows—has been championed by several charities, companies, and individuals. One can ask how those critical of the contemporary dairy industry, including especially vegans and others sympathetic to animal rights, should respond to this prospect. In this paper, I explore three kinds of challenges that such people may have to clean milk: first, that producing clean milk fails to respect animals; second, that humans should not consume dairy products; and third, that the creation of clean milk would affirm human superiority over cows. None of these challenges, I argue, gives us reason to reject clean milk. I thus conclude that the prospect is one that animal activists should both welcome and embrace. Keywords Milk Á Food technology Á Biotechnology Á Animal rights Á Animal ethics Á Veganism Introduction A number of businesses, charities, and individuals are working to develop ‘‘clean milk’’—dairy products created by biotechnological means, without the need for cows. In this paper, I complement scientific work on this possibility by offering the first normative examination of clean dairy. After explaining why this question warrants consideration, I consider three kinds of objections that vegans and animal activists may have to clean milk. It is more difficult to distance ourselves from our own views, so that we can dispassionately search for prejudices among the beliefs and values we hold.” - Peter Singer “It's a matter of taking the side of the weak against the strong, something the best people have always done.” - Harriet Beecher Stowe In my experience of teaching philosophy, ethics and logic courses, I have found that no topic brings out the rational and emotional best and worst in people than ethical questions about the treatment of animals. This is not surprising since, unlike questions about social policy, generally about what other people should do, moral questions about animals are personal. As philosopher Peter Singer has observed, “For most human beings, especially in modern urban and suburban communities, the most direct form of contact with non-human animals is at mealtimes: we eat Between the Species, VIII, August 2008, cla.calpoly.edu/bts/ 1 them.”1 For most of us, then, our own daily behaviors and choices are challenged when we reflect on the reasons given to think that change is needed in our treatment of, and attitudes toward, animals. That the issue is personal presents unique challenges, and great opportunities, for intellectual and moral progress. Here I present some of the reasons given for and against taking animals seriously and reflect on the role of reason in our lives. -

DAIRY COW UNIFIED SCORECARD Breed characteristics should be considered in the application of this scorecard. Perfect MAJOR TRAIT DESCRIPTIONS Score There are four major breakdowns on which to base a cow’s evaluation. Each trait is broken down into body parts to be considered and ranked. 1) Frame - 15% The skeletal parts of the cow, with the exception of rear feet and legs. Listed in priority order, the descriptions of the traits to be considered are as follows: Rump (5 points): Should be long and wide throughout. Pin bones should be slightly lower than hip bones with adequate width between the pins. Thurls 15 should be wide apart. Vulva should be nearly vertical and the anus should not be recessed. Tail head should set slightly above and neatly between pin bones with freedom from coarseness. Front End (5 points): Adequate constitution with front legs straight, wide apart, and squarely placed. Shoulder blades and elbows set firmly against the chest wall. The crops should have adequate fullness blending into the shoulders. Back/Loin (2 points): Back should be straight and strong, with loin broad, strong, and nearly level. Stature (2 points): Height including length in the leg bones with a long bone pattern throughout the body structure. Height at withers and hips should be relatively proportionate. Age and breed stature recommendations are to be considered. Breed Characteristics (1 point): Exhibiting overall style and balance. Head should be feminine, clean-cut, slightly dished with broad muzzle, large open nostrils and strong jaw. 2) Dairy Strength - 25% A combination of dairyness and strength that supports sustained production and longevity.
